/**
* Calculations for all dynamic viscosity units
*
* @var array
*/
protected $_units = [
'CENTIPOISE' => ['0.001', 'cP'],
'DECIPOISE' => ['0.01', 'dP'],
'DYNE_SECOND_PER_SQUARE_CENTIMETER' => ['0.1', 'dyn s/cm²'],
'GRAM_FORCE_SECOND_PER_SQUARE_CENTIMETER' => ['98.0665', 'gf s/cm²'],
'GRAM_PER_CENTIMETER_SECOND' => ['0.1', 'g/cm s'],
'KILOGRAM_FORCE_SECOND_PER_SQUARE_METER' => ['9.80665', 'kgf s/m²'],
'KILOGRAM_PER_METER_HOUR' => [['' => '1', '/' => '3600'], 'kg/m h'],
'KILOGRAM_PER_METER_SECOND' => ['1', 'kg/ms'],
'MILLIPASCAL_SECOND' => ['0.001', 'mPa s'],
'MILLIPOISE' => ['0.0001', 'mP'],
'NEWTON_SECOND_PER_SQUARE_METER' => ['1', 'N s/m²'],
'PASCAL_SECOND' => ['1', 'Pa s'],
'POISE' => ['0.1', 'P'],
'POISEUILLE' => ['1', 'Pl'],
'POUND_FORCE_SECOND_PER_SQUARE_FEET' => ['47.880259', 'lbf s/ft²'],
'POUND_FORCE_SECOND_PER_SQUARE_INCH' => ['6894.75729', 'lbf s/in²'],
'POUND_PER_FOOT_HOUR' => ['0.00041337887', 'lb/ft h'],
'POUND_PER_FOOT_SECOND' => ['1.4881639', 'lb/ft s'],
'POUNDAL_HOUR_PER_SQUARE_FOOT' => ['0.00041337887', 'pdl h/ft²'],
'POUNDAL_SECOND_PER_SQUARE_FOOT' => ['1.4881639', 'pdl s/ft²'],
'REYN' => ['6894.75729', 'reyn'],
'SLUG_PER_FOOT_SECOND'=> ['47.880259', 'slug/ft s'],
'WATER_20C' => ['0.001', 'water (20°)'],
'WATER_40C' => ['0.00065', 'water (40°)'],
'HEAVY_OIL_20C' => ['0.45', 'oil (20°)'],
'HEAVY_OIL_40C' => ['0.11', 'oil (40°)'],
'GLYCERIN_20C' => ['1.41', 'glycerin (20°)'],
'GLYCERIN_40C' => ['0.284', 'glycerin (40°)'],
'SAE_5W_MINUS18C' => ['1.2', 'SAE 5W (-18°)'],
'SAE_10W_MINUS18C' => ['2.4', 'SAE 10W (-18°)'],
'SAE_20W_MINUS18C' => ['9.6', 'SAE 20W (-18°)'],
'SAE_5W_99C' => ['0.0039', 'SAE 5W (99°)'],
'SAE_10W_99C' => ['0.0042', 'SAE 10W (99°)'],
'SAE_20W_99C' => ['0.0057', 'SAE 20W (99°)'],
'STANDARD' => 'KILOGRAM_PER_METER_SECOND'
];
}
